When's the best time to book a family-friendly vacation in Palo Alto?
The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 69°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 53°F. Average annual precipitation for Palo Alto is 18 inches.

What's the best way for us to get around Palo Alto?
To see more of the surrounding area, ride one of the trains from California Ave Station or Palo Alto Station. Palo Alto might not have very many public transit options to choose from so consider renting a car to explore more.
